What is included in the tour price?
The $77 fee includes transportation from and to your accommodation, gear (wetsuits and surfboards), insurance, and instruction from a professional level 2 surf instructor.
Can I join if I have never surfed before?
Yes, this experience is designed for all levels, including complete beginners. The instructor will tailor the session to your experience level to ensure safety and enjoyment.
What should I bring?
Bring a towel and water. The provided gear keeps you warm and safe, but having your own towel and hydration is recommended for comfort and energy.
How long is the session?
The lesson lasts approximately 2 hours, starting with land-based theory and exercises, followed by water practice and a refreshment break.
Is transportation included?
Yes, pickup and drop-off from your accommodation in Ericeira are included, making it very convenient.
What if the surf conditions aren’t suitable?
You will be notified in advance, and you can choose whether to proceed or reschedule, ensuring you only surf in good conditions.
What languages are the guides available in?
Guides speak English, Portuguese, French, and Spanish, facilitating clear communication for a diverse group.
Can I book for a group or just myself?
The experience is limited to small groups of up to 5 participants, ideal for personalized attention. Solo bookings are welcome.
